The Search Landscape in 2026
Traditional Search (Still Dominant)
Google, Bing, and others still drive the majority of web traffic. Core SEO fundamentals haven't changed:
- Quality content that answers real questions
- Technical performance (speed, mobile, Core Web Vitals)
- Backlinks and domain authority
- Structured data and semantic markup
AI-Powered Search (Growing Fast)
When someone asks ChatGPT or Perplexity "what's the best CRM for small businesses?" and your product appears in the answer, that's a new kind of discovery. Gemini has ~400 million monthly users. Traffic from AI assistants converts at 4.4x the rate of traditional organic search — fewer visits, but much higher intent.
AI search pulls from:
- High-authority content with clear, factual claims
- Well-structured pages that LLMs can parse
- Content that answers specific questions directly
- Data, comparisons, and original research
- Brand trust signals: reviews, ratings, PR mentions, expert citations — entity authority matters more than keyword targeting
Google AI Overviews
Google now shows AI-generated summaries above traditional results for many queries — and 14% of AI Overviews are transactional, meaning they directly impact purchase decisions. To appear in these:
- Be the source AI cites (authoritative, specific, trustworthy). E-E-A-T (Experience, Expertise, Authoritativeness, Trustworthiness) is now non-negotiable.
- Use structured data (FAQ schema, HowTo schema, Review schema)
- Answer the question in the first paragraph (then go deep)
- Make content "citation-ready": concise, declarative statements with original data that AI can extract verbatim
Optimizing for Both Worlds
1. Answer the Question First
Old SEO: Bury the answer after a 500-word intro to maximize time on page. New SEO: Answer the question immediately. Then provide depth. AI models extract the direct answer. Users stay for the depth.
2. Use Clear Structure
AI models parse headers, lists, and tables better than dense paragraphs. Structure your content like a well-organized reference, not a meandering essay.
3. Include Original Data
AI models love citing specific numbers, studies, and original research. If you run a real survey or analysis, publish the results — specific, sourced data gets cited. "Many marketers use AI" without data behind it is not citable.
4. Build Topic Authority
Don't write one article about a topic. Write a cluster: a pillar page plus 5-10 supporting articles that link to each other. AI models recognize topical authority.
Fun theory: AI models cite sources. If your content isn't citable, it's invisible. Be the source — specific, factual, structured — and you show up everywhere.
5. Technical Foundations
- Structured data: JSON-LD for products, articles, FAQs, how-tos
- Fast loading: Under 2.5 seconds Largest Contentful Paint
- Mobile-first: Responsive, touch-friendly, readable
- Clean URLs: Descriptive, hierarchical, stable
- Sitemap and indexing: Help search engines and AI crawlers find everything
AI Tools for SEO
| Tool | What It Does |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Ahrefs / Semrush | Keyword research, competitive analysis, rank tracking, AI visibility | $100-400/month |
| SurferSEO / Clearscope | AI-powered content optimization against top-ranking pages | $50-200/month |
| Peec AI / Profound AI | LLM visibility tracking — monitors how AI models reference your brand | Varies |
| Claude / ChatGPT | Generate meta descriptions, title tags, FAQ schema content | Varies |
| Screaming Frog | Technical SEO audits | Free (limited) to $260/year |
| Google Search Console | Performance data, indexing issues | Free |
